WebApr 21, 2024 · 6. It Usually has Four Strings, but not Always. If you’ve ever seen an orchestral double bass, it most likely had four strings pitched to E–A–D–G. However, you may also find a double bass with five strings with a fifth string added to the higher register. This allows the musician to play higher notes than they can with just four strings. 7. WebMar 11, 2024 · The two instruments are tuned C-G-D-A. The 4-string tenor domra is tuned like the octave mandolin, an octave below the standard mandolin and prima domra (G-D-A-E) The 4-string bass domra has more in common with the mandocello, which is an octave lower than the mandola and alto domra (C-G-D-A). Violas and violins have the most similar dimensions, causing confusion. At around 36cm long, a violin’s smaller body adds to its brighter tone.

WebThe violin typically has four strings, usually tuned in perfect fifths with notes G3, D4, A4, E5, and is most commonly played by drawing a bow across its strings. WebThe string section is composed of bowed instruments belonging to the violin family. It normally consists of first and second violins, violas, cellos, and double basses.
